Cover Letter Tips: Crafting a Winning Document with Monster's Insights

In the competitive job market, a well-crafted cover letter can make all the difference in landing your
dream job. Monster, a renowned job search and career platform, offers invaluable insights and tips to
help you create a compelling cover letter that stands out from the rest.

1. Introduction that Grabs Attention Your cover letter's opening is crucial. Monster advises
starting with a compelling introduction that immediately captures the reader's attention.
Consider mentioning a recent accomplishment or expressing your enthusiasm for the position
to make a memorable first impression.
2. Tailor to the Job Description Monster emphasizes the importance of tailoring your cover
letter to the specific job you're applying for. Highlight your skills and experiences that
directly align with the requirements mentioned in the job description. This personalized touch
demonstrates your genuine interest and suitability for the role.
3. Showcase Achievements and Skills Instead of reiterating your resume, Monster suggests
using the cover letter to showcase specific achievements and skills that make you an ideal
candidate. Use quantifiable examples to demonstrate your impact in previous roles, providing
evidence of your abilities and accomplishments.
4. Express Passion and Enthusiasm Employers appreciate candidates who are genuinely
passionate about the opportunity. Monster recommends expressing your enthusiasm for the
company and the position in your cover letter. This personal touch can set you apart and
show that you are not just seeking any job but are genuinely interested in contributing to the
organization's success.
5. Address Employment Gaps or Career Changes If you have employment gaps or are
making a career change, Monster advises addressing these aspects in your cover letter. Be
honest and proactive in explaining any gaps, emphasizing how your experiences during those
periods have contributed to your overall skill set and readiness for the new role.
6. Conclude with a Strong Closing A strong conclusion is essential to leave a lasting
impression. Monster recommends summarizing your key points and expressing your
eagerness for an interview. Include a call-to-action, inviting the employer to contact you to
discuss your qualifications further.
7. Professional Formatting and Tone Monster stresses the importance of maintaining a
professional tone and formatting throughout your cover letter. Use clear and concise
language, and ensure your letter is well-organized with proper grammar and punctuation. A
polished document reflects your attention to detail and professionalism.
